Moxibusion
Affectionately known as Moxa, this form of dried compressed mugwort is even older than acupuncture as a therapeutic method. The meridians that Chinese Medicine is based on were originally discovered by burning this gentle warming incense at the end of a meridian and having the subject share where the heat moved to.
